About Jae Suk Kim
Jae Suk Kim is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ging and Public Health, Environmental and Occupational Health, having authored 55 papers that have together received 664 indexed citations. Recurring topics across this work include Retinal Diseases and Treatments (24 papers), Glaucoma and retinal disorders (24 papers) and Retinal Imaging and Analysis (11 papers). The work is most often cited by research in Ophthalmology (554 citations), Radiology, Nuclear Medicine and Imaging (384 citations) and Otorhinolaryngology (16 citations). Jae Suk Kim has collaborated with scholars based in South Korea, United States and Mexico. Frequent co-authors include William R. Freeman, Jay Chhablani, Igor Kozak, Je Hyung Hwang, Kathrin Hartmann, Lingyun Cheng, Stephen F. Oster, Igor Kozak, Jae‐Yong Park and Jae-Yong Park.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Ophthalmology.
